Project of worm gear for lift mechanism
Otisk, Jan ; Malach, František (referee) ; Malášek, Jiří (advisor)
This graduation thesis dwells on a worm gear design for an elevator mechanism in an already existing wheel case with actuator unit S3 for elevator type BOV 320/0,63. The work includes dimensional and control calculation for the worm gear and as an attachment you will find spiral worm and worm gear drawing documentation, including its specific location.
The screw conveyor of aggregate
Novák, Pavel ; Jonák, Martin (referee) ; Řezníček, Milan (advisor)
This bachelor's thesis deals with the design of the screw conveyor for transport of aggregate. It consists of a technical report containing mainly conceptual design of the entire device, calculation of the main dimensions, design a functional drive and choice of flexible shaft coupling, load calculation, selection and checking of bearings and strength control of structural components, plus drawings, which consists of a set of proposed installation, detailed subassemblies of the attachments of worm shaft in all bearings, welding subassemblies of the trough and production drawing of the input pin.
Pipe screw conveyor for fly ash transport
Žaloudek, Vilém ; Zeizinger, Lukáš (referee) ; Škopán, Miroslav (advisor)
This bachelor's thesis deals with design and constructional solution of oblique tubular screw conveyor for transportation of power plant ash from silo to further technological processing. In this thesis evaluation of fundamental dimensions, design of power unit, design of bearings, evaluation of filling of the through and strength control of selected components of screw conveyor is done. This thesis consists of evaluation report and drawing documentation.
Shaft Machining on a CNC Machine
Prášil, František ; Jaroš, Aleš (referee) ; Kalivoda, Milan (advisor)
This bachelor thesis is focused on design and subsequent production of a rotational component - a worm shaft for tractor Zetor 25A steering. The technology chosen for this purpose is machining with assistance of driven tool milling on CNC lathe. Within this bachelor thesis an investigation of CNC machines available in the production company has been performed. Furthermore a proposal of production technology process of the component has been carried out along with a technical report containing economical assessment.
Worm conveyor
Sedláček, Martin ; Jonák, Martin (referee) ; Malášek, Jiří (advisor)
This bachelor thesis deals with calculation and construction of worm conveyor for slightly sloping transport. The whole work is divided into two main sections, which include structural and textual parts. The text contains analysis of option for single parts of conveyor, functional and strength calculations, which are necessary for proposal of worm conveyor. The structural part includes mechanical drawings, which consists of drawing of configuration and drawings of details for worm shaft.
Technological project of component manufacturing
Beháň, Jakub ; Chladil, Josef (referee) ; Kalivoda, Milan (advisor)
The primary objective of this bachelor thesis is to replace the standard method of manufacturing for universal machines with a higher version according to the technical opportunities that are possible nowadays, ie. CNC machines. The introductory part of the thesis describes the characteristics of the selected part. The following section describes the proposal for universal machines. The proposal consists of the elaboration of the technological procedure and description of used universal machines and tools. The next part moves the current technological process to a higher level, using CNC technology. After the technological process is made, the production of sample is described in the penultimate chapter. The last chapter is based on evaluation of technical-economic aspects including ecology. In the final part, the bachelor thesis is extended with a chapter of discussion, whose task is to introduce an alternative production using turn technology.
